Transaction

0507bd19f435b3ff604deedbac86fdc14f1b0128f07bf82ec76eb51d0caaeb5c
60,128 confirmations
Timestamp
1735934540
Block877,684
Fee945 sats
Fee rate6.70 sats/vB
view on mempool.space

Inputs & Outputs